Doctor Who opens its Tardis door

A big new Doctor Who tourist attraction opened yesterday.

The Doctor Who Experience in Cardiff Bay offers fans of the hit sci-fi show the chance to ride in a Tardis as well as to come face to face with some of the Time Lord's most formidable enemies.

It is packed with dozens of rare artefacts and props from the show's 49-year history. It is sited near the new studios where the show is filmed and is expected to attract up to 250,000 visitors a year.

The organisers hope the building, which resembles a giant slug, will become a draw for fans and a top tourist attraction in Wales.
